Blue Protocol Will Be Released in North America Courtesy of Amazon Games

At The Game Awards, Bandai Namco has announced that it will publish Blue Protocol when it is released outside of Japan in 2023.

Blue Protocol is Bandai Namco’s anime-inspired MMORPG where players can create their own custom character and choose between five classes. The developers are calling Blue Protocol an anime come to life.

The MMO was co-developed by Bandai Namco Online and Bandai Namco Studios and is set in the world of Regnas, which is facing the brink of destruction. Players will harness a power called Flux to defeat foes and team up with allies to face the oncoming threats.

The five classes include Blade Warden, Twin Striker, Keen Strider, Spell Weaver, and Foe Breaker.

Amazon Games tells IGN that Blue Protocol began development around the spring of 2015, meaning this project has been in the works for several years before finally coming out in 2023.

This will be the latest live-service online game published by Amazon Games following titles like New World, which was developed by Amazon Game Studios, and Lost Ark which was developed by Korean company Smilegate.
